This alert fires when the rate of rejected idempotency keys on the Tollgate retry pipeline exceeds the rolling threshold, usually indicating a client regenerating keys on retry or a cache eviction in the Keyvault shim. Duplicate charges are prevented, but retries will fail until keys stabilize. Before approving the next release train, verify the key-generation change in the candidate build and review the rejection dashboard. For pre-release sign-off questions, contact the payments platform owners at the address below.

escalation mailbox, bafog-fafog: ulador@paliqlabs.internal

Changed defaults in Splitfork, our assignment service. Bucketing now uses sticky hashing per account instead of per session, and the holdout slice grew from 2% to 5%. Callers relying on session-level reassignment must opt in explicitly. Review the diff against the new baseline; the updated default configuration is listed below.

config for tagep-kajof:
[casir]
port = 6379
region = south-1
host = casir.paliqdyn.example
team = tamax
timeout_ms = 250
retries = 2

MINUTES — Management Meeting, Training Budget

Present: Orla Fenwick (chair), Dax Mirren, Tilly Brosh.

Welcome aboard — these notes are mainly for you. We agreed to bump the training budget by 15% next year, with most of it going to the Calder certification track and a smaller pot for leadership coaching at the Renhollow site. Dax flagged that vendor quotes from Quillstone Learning are still pending. Tilly will draft the allocation by month-end. One more thing you should see before signing off.

board note of fahag-tajop: The eastern region missed its Julix quota by 44.0 percent last quarter. Ralionax Holdings plans to lower the Druath list price by 61.8 percent in March. The board signed off on a budget of $295.0 million for Project Gilath. The renewal with Ruswynix Systems closes at $274.5 million a year, 17.0 percent above the last contract.